
A pond in Trafalgar Square, London, reflecting the dome of the National Gallery.
For Debbie’s One Word Sunday.
#OneWordSunday
#OWS

A pond in Trafalgar Square, London, reflecting the dome of the National Gallery.
For Debbie’s One Word Sunday.
#OneWordSunday
#OWS
A clever shot and a gentle teal 🙂
LikeLike